New 2011 / 2012 Ferrari 612 is 4×4 Shooting Brake
Fri, 31 Dec 2010The 2011 / 2012 Ferrari 612 will be a 4x4 Shooting Brake (render by Vandenbrink design) Last month we had an email in from Argentina pointing us towards spy shots published by Autoblog Argentina which seemed to be of an all wheel drive Ferrari 612. Which tied in very well with the story we ran over a year ago when we reported that a 4×4 platform for the next Ferrari 612 was a certainty, just six months after we reported Ferrari were working on four wheel drive hybrid propulsion system. But the Ferrari 4×4 setup is very different to the permanent all wheel drive system used by Lamborghini.

First Sight: Peugeot 907 concept
Fri, 03 Sep 2004Making its debut at the Paris Motor Show, the Peugeot 907 concept is a two-seater GT coupe, created "with reference to the past, the present and the future", and intended to transcend the Marque's values. The 907 is powered by a 6.0 litre V12 engine delivering 368 kW (500 bhp), positioned longitudinally behind the front axle. Connected by a short propshaft, it transmits its power to a six-speed sequentially controlled gearbox placed longitudinally in front of the rear axle.
